DIY Essential Oil Playdough

What You Need:

  • 3 cups flour
  • 1 cup salt
  • 1 tbsp cream of tartar
  • 3 tablespoon oil
  • 3 cups cold water
  • A few drops of your choice of essential oil
  • Food coloring, optional

Directions:

  1. Combine flour, salt, cream of tartar together in a large bowl
  2. In a saucepan bring water to a boil
  3. Pour 1 cup of your boiling water to the mixture and stir, adding an additional ½ cup slowly until desired consistency is reached.
  4. Let cool, split into 12 balls, and knead in essential oils and food coloring until it is distributed evenly throughout each ball of playdough.
  5. Let your kids enjoy this natural play dough and when done, store in an airtight container.

Dry Cuticle Healing Oil

I put together this cuticle oil blend for those of us that get dry cracked cuticle’s year round. This will help soften, moisturize and heal your cuticles that are cracked and sore.

10 drops Lavender
10 drops Frankincense
10 drops Melaleuca ( Tea Tree)
5 drops Helichrysum

Fill a roller bottle, or a dropper bottle with the above oils and top with Avocado Oil. Avocado Oil works well with dry sensitive skin, and promotes cuticle health.

If you can’t use Lavender try Rosemary Essential Oil instead.

Strong Diffuser Blend

Step 1

Mix 1 drop Thyme, 4 drops Lemongrass and 3 drops Wintergreen. Add to a diffuser.

Essential Oils for Anxiety

There are several types of anxiety that people can suffer from, and there are essential oils to help with each type.

Tense Anxiety usually involves bodily tension, muscle pains, aches, sore body. The essential oils that can help with tense anxiety symptoms are sandalwood, lavender, clary sage, roman chamomile, patchouli, and cinnamon.
TENSE ANXIETY BLEND
10 drops Clary Sage
15 drops Lavender
5 drops Roman Chamomile

Restless Anxiety symptoms are over activity, sweating, palpitations, dizziness, lump in throat, frequent urination or diarrhea (over activity of the autonomic nervous system)
Essential oils: vetiver, atlas cedarwood, juniper berry, roman chamomile, frankincense, mandarin
RESTLESS ANXIETY BLEND
5 drops Vetiver
10 drops Juniper Berry
15 drops Atlas Cedarwood

Apprehensive Anxiety includes unease, apprehension, worrying, brooding, over anxiousness, paranoia, and a sense of foreboding.
Essential oils: bergamot, lavender, neroli, rose, melissa, geranium, atlas cedarwood , patchouli, orange (sweet)
APPREHENSIVE ANXIETY BLEND
15 drops Bergamot
5 drops Lavender
10 drops Geranium

Repressed Anxiety symptoms include feeling on edge, irritable, difficulty in concentrating, insomnia, and feeling exhausted all the time. The essential oils that can help alleviate these symptoms are bergamot, melissa, neroli, rose, sandalwood, vetiver, and atlas cedarwood .
REPRESSED ANXIETY BLEND
10 drops Neroli
10 Rose
10 drops Bergamot
Worwood, Valerie Ann. The Complete Book of Essential Oils and Aromatherapy, Revised and Expanded: Over 800 Natural, Nontoxic, and Fragrant Recipes to Create Health, Beauty, and Safe Home and Work Environments (p. 101). New World Library. Kindle Edition.
